Continuing saga of a rough running engine


I had a 95 mustang with a blow engine. I got the block refurbished and with 2 refurbished heads had a professional to install the engine. For eight months the car was running like a dream giving 24 mpg. Two weeks ago the engine started to run rough. The check engine light came on giving a code P0305. Gas fume cam though the air vents. I changed plugs wires but there was not any improvemnts. The check codes did change to P0500. I noticed that on spark plug # 2 was wet. I change the injector but no effect. I change the cam senser and the coil pack but no improvements. With the rough runnimg engine I am lucky to get 10 mpg.

Any sugestion.
